Description
Founded in 1829, St. Joseph Orphanage (SJO) was known for over 150 years throughout the Ohio Valley region as a traditional orphanage. But, by the early 1970's, SJO had responded to the increasing need for children's mental health care in a more complex and fragmented society by offering innovative new approaches and programs.
Today, St. Joseph Orphanage is a comprehensive children's mental health, educational, and residential treatment agency that provides services to children that struggle due to a history of abuse, neglect, emotional disturbances, or developmental disabilities.
